The book begins by reviewing Newtonian mechanics, focusing on conservation laws (momentum, angular momentum, and energy). It quickly elevates the discussion to systems of particles, introducing the concepts of external and internal forces, constraints, and degrees of freedom. Classical mechanics is a fundamental branch of physics that deals with the study of the motion of macroscopic objects under the influence of forces. The book "Classical Mechanics" by NC Rana and PS Joag is a renowned textbook that provides a comprehensive introduction to the subject. The authors, both eminent physicists, have presented the subject matter in a clear and concise manner, making it an ideal resource for undergraduate and graduate students.
